At a glance

About this item

Highlights

  • 35+ hours playtime: 8+ hours in earbuds and 3 full charges from the case
  • Dual Connect – use each earbud independently or use both together. A built-in MEMS microphone in each bud ensures clear calls.
  • Small and compact design to fit in your pocket, they are 15% smaller than the GO Air and 40% lighter
  • JLab App connectivity. Control all aspects of EQ, enable Be Aware Mode and more with the new JLab App
  • Touch controls for volume and tracks, play/pause, answering calls and activating your smart assistant
  • Sweat + splashproof with an IPX4 rating
  • Includes 3 soft gel tips
  • 100% recyclable packaging

Description

The JLab GO Air POP true wireless earbuds have changed the game for accessible audio products. Perfectly pocket-sized with a powerful punch, these earbuds feature JLab App Connectivity, touch sensors, universal mics in both earbuds, and IPX4 water resistance. Ready for business calls to workouts and everything in between, the GO Air POP earbuds have a massive 35+ hour total playtime, with 8+ hours in each earbud off a single charge and 3 more charges from the case. Listen, take calls and enjoy life on-the-GO.
Weight: .15 Pounds
Water Resistance: Water-Resistant, Sweat-Resistant
Ear Cushion Material: Silicone
Estimated Charge Time: 2 Hours
Connection Type: No Wired Connection Ports
Wireless Technology: Bluetooth
Package Quantity: 1
Noise Canceling: No Active Noise Canceling
Microphone: Built-In Microphone
Maximum Battery Charge Life: 32 Hours
Wireless Type: True Wireless
Battery: 3 Non-Universal Lithium Ion, Required, Non-Removable

Q: Can you plug these into your phone to charge the earbuds?

submitted by Mia - 1 year ago
  • A: Hi Mia, thanks for reaching out about JLab GO Air Pop True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ds. No, you cannot directly plug the JLab GO Air Pop earbuds into your phone to charge them. Here's why: Charging Case is Essential: The JLab GO Air Pop earbuds are charged by placing them inside their charging case. The case itself has a built-in battery and is what provides the power to recharge the earbuds. Case Charging: To recharge the case, you use the integrated USB cable that's attached to the case. You can plug this cable into a USB port on your computer, a wall adapter, or a portable power bank. Important Note: While you can't plug the earbuds directly into your phone, some newer JLab earbuds (like the JBuds Mini, JBuds ANC 3, and others) have a feature where you can actually use your phone to charge the case itself. This is helpful if you're in a pinch and don't have access to a traditional power source. However, the JLab GO Air Pop does not have this feature.
